Abstract

In this paper, we investigate the problem of designing H filter for a class of linear descriptor systems which can be realized in practice. It is established that the solution to the filtering problem can be cast in the format of linear matrix inequalities (LMIs). An important special cases is provided. A numerical example is worked out to illustrate the theoretical developments.
